Which of the following is an example of an overuse injury?
faust18 [17]
D. Tendonitis

A broken leg can result from a bad tackle or jump, a torn ligament can also be a bad tackle, and a hematoma can come from a hit to the head.

Tendonitis is the inflammation of the tendons which is caused by overusage. If muscles or tendons don't have time to heal like after a week of running then they would be used too much...
